Solvent Cleaning for Precision Applications

Solvent cleaning is an essential process in various precision applications. It entails the employment of solvents to thoroughly remove contaminants, such as oils, greases, fluxes, and particles, from delicate components. The stringent nature of precision applications necessitates a precise cleaning process to ensure optimal operation. Solvents chosen for these scenarios must possess superior dissolving power, affinity with the materials being cleaned, and minimal influence on the components' structure.

A thorough understanding of the characteristics of different solvents is vital for selecting the most appropriate solvent for a specific application.

Eradicating Adhesive Residue

Sticky residue can be a real nuisance. Whether it's from tape, it often leaves behind an unsightly mess. Fortunately, there are several effective techniques for removing adhesive residue.

Here are a few tips to get rolling:

* **Oil-based Products:** Olive oil can work wonders on resistive residue. Apply a a drop and let it sit for a few minutes. Then, gently rub the area with a cloth or paper towel.

* **WD-40:** This versatile product can also be effective in breaking down adhesive. Spray a small amount onto the residue and let it soak. After a few moments, wipe away the residue with a cloth.

* **Alcohol:** Isopropyl alcohol can dissolve many types of adhesive. Apply a small amount to a cloth and gently rub the affected area. Be sure to test in an inconspicuous area first, as alcohol can sometimes damage some surfaces.

Powerful Component Cleaners

When selecting a thorough component cleaning agent, it's essential to consider the specific components you're working with. Some agents are designed for delicate electronic circuits, while others are formulated to tackle tough grease and grime on industrial machinery. Always consult the manufacturer's instructions carefully to ensure safe and effective cleaning.

A well-rounded agent should effectively remove contaminants without causing damage or leaving behind residues that could affect performance.

Consider factors such as solvent type, concentration, and application method when making your choice.
